Track limits changed after F1 Friday practice

Race control will now monitor track limits at Turn 5 Formula 1 teams have been advised that race control has changed its stance on track limits following the opening day of the Portuguese Grand Prix. Ahead of the weekend, FIA race director Michael Masi confirmed that officials would be monitoring the exits of Turn 1, 4, and 15. Following Friday’s two 60-minute practice sessions, the exit of Turn 5 has now been added to that list.
